summ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
Diffstat (limited to 'src')
-rw-r--r--src/svg/qsvgfont.cpp4
-rw-r--r--src/svg/qsvghandler.cpp4
2 files changed, 4 insertions, 4 deletions
diff --git a/src/svg/qsvgfont.cpp b/src/svg/qsvgfont.cpp
index 6487de4..eb6c9cf 100644
--- a/src/svg/qsvgfont.cpp
+++ b/src/svg/qsvgfont.cpp
@@ -84,7 +84,7 @@ void QSvgFont::draw(QPainter *p, const QPointF &point, const QString &str, qreal
for ( ; itr != str.constEnd(); ++itr) {
QChar unicode = *itr;
if (!m_glyphs.contains(*itr)) {
- unicode = 0;
+ unicode = u'\0';
if (!m_glyphs.contains(unicode))
continue;
}
@@ -112,7 +112,7 @@ void QSvgFont::draw(QPainter *p, const QPointF &point, const QString &str, qreal
for ( ; itr != str.constEnd(); ++itr) {
QChar unicode = *itr;
if (!m_glyphs.contains(*itr)) {
- unicode = 0;
+ unicode = u'\0';
if (!m_glyphs.contains(unicode))
continue;
}
diff --git a/src/svg/qsvghandler.cpp b/src/svg/qsvghandler.cpp
index 9fe892d..5e7607a 100644
--- a/src/svg/qsvghandler.cpp
+++ b/src/svg/qsvghandler.cpp
@@ -938,7 +938,7 @@ static bool createSvgGlyph(QSvgFont *font, const QXmlStreamAttributes &attribute
QStringView havStr = attributes.value(QLatin1String("horiz-adv-x"));
QStringView pathStr = attributes.value(QLatin1String("d"));
- QChar unicode = (uncStr.isEmpty()) ? 0 : uncStr.at(0);
+ QChar unicode = (uncStr.isEmpty()) ? u'\0' : uncStr.at(0);
qreal havx = (havStr.isEmpty()) ? -1 : toDouble(havStr);
QPainterPath path;
path.setFillRule(Qt::WindingFill);
@@ -1594,7 +1594,7 @@ static bool parsePathDataFast(QStringView dataStr, QPainterPath &path)
QChar pathElem = *str;
++str;
QChar endc = *end;
- *const_cast<QChar *>(end) = 0; // parseNumbersArray requires 0-termination that QStringView cannot guarantee
+ *const_cast<QChar *>(end) = u'\0'; // parseNumbersArray requires 0-termination that QStringView cannot guarantee
QVarLengthArray<qreal, 8> arg;
parseNumbersArray(str, arg);
*const_cast<QChar *>(end) = endc;